일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|
Tags
- mybatis
- 풀스택
- 서블릿
- 프레임워크
- 제이쿼리
- 비밀번호찾기
- MVC
- 회원가입
- 스프링
- spring
- 로그인
- 미로 생성 알고리즘
- css3
- Linked List
- 네비게이터
- 마이바티스
- 웹페이지
- dbms
- 웹개발
- Ajax
- 프론트엔드
- javascript
- jQuery
- 웹서비스
- Binding
- 백엔드
- html5
- 오라클
- c programming
- jsp
Archives
- Today
- Total
목록전체 글 (41)
Programmer's Progress

#include #include typedef struct node { int data; struct node *p_next; }NODE; void push(NODE **p_head, NODE **p_tail, int data) { //**p_head : 노드의 시작 포인터 주소를 받는다. //**p_tail : 노드의 끝 포인터 주소를 받는다. push 작업을 할때 반복문을 사용하지 않고 //바로 추가하기 위해서 필요하다. //data : 추가하고자 하는 정보 //헤드포인터가 널이 아니라면 이는 이미 데이터가 하나 이상은 추가되었다는 의미다. if (*p_head != NULL) { //맨 마지막 노드의 다음 노드를 위한 공간을 확보한다. (*p_tail)->p_next = (NODE*)malloc(s..
C Programming/Project
2021. 1. 24. 17:45